Description: This copy is Signed, with a personalized inscription, by the editor. A short section of illustrations includes two maps. Frontis portrait plate. The publisher's author-blurb reads: the editor, ''Dr Lawrence A Frost has served as a vocational curator of the Custer Room in the Monroe County Historical Museum for over twenty-five years. He has written several books on Custer lore. His strong interest in Custer grew from having lived in Custer's hometown for nearly fifty years and having become closely associated with members of the General's family.'' James Calhoun was an officer of the Seventh Cavalry and General Custer's brother-in-law. Calhoun served as Acting Assistant Adjutant General during the Black Hills Expedition. The book blurb tells us: '' More than a military log, Calhoun's diary offers readers insights and opinions of significant events, as well as numerous letters, reports, and dispatches of importance to the expedition.''
